Multitasking debunked - Good Experience
Multitasking debunked on NPR: "People can't multitask very well, and when people say they can, they're deluding themselves," said neuroscientist Earl Miller. And, he said, "The brain is very good at deluding itself."

Feature: Practicing Simplified GTD
In short, I can describe my GTD system in eight words. Make three lists. Revise them daily and weekly.
